Survival in the Shadows of North Korea
This chapter explores the speaker's traumatic experiences growing up in North Korea under a repressive regime, highlighting extreme class divisions and systemic oppression. It focuses on the harrowing realities of famine, severe malnutrition, and a lack of basic human rights, revealing the stark contrasts between urban and rural life. The discussion also reflects on the concept of guilt and shame in relation to social mobility and historical injustices, drawing poignant comparisons with Western cultures.
